Just as Lian Hua was about to continue, Xiao Jizi reminded her, and she paused, her train of thought breaking for a moment: "Ah?"
After a brief thought, she also realized that she had misspoken.
Ah, that was close. She almost sentenced Xiao Linzi to death.
She sheepishly chuckled twice: "That, cough~ I misspoke, the death penalty can be pardoned, but the living sentence cannot be escaped, cough cough..."
Everyone heaved a sigh of relief. That explained it, a simple mix-up. The mistress/Little Lady wouldn’t be that cruel.
Lian Hua touched her somewhat hot face, coughed twice to mask her embarrassment. Just when she was trying to display her authority, she misspoke. Gosh, that was embarrassing. Thankfully, it was just among her own people. No worries, no worries.
Clearing her throat, she resumed: "Cough, so, to continue, Xiao Linzi’s death penalty is pardoned, but the living sentence cannot be escaped.
From today on, you are officially relieved from your lookout duties.
These duties will now be handed over to Xiao Jizi.
When you are carrying out tasks in the future, you mustn’t be distracted by counting pebbles again.
And you’re also to be punished by spanking your palm three times.
If I punish you this way, do you have any objections? "
Xiao Linzi let out a big sigh of relief, as if he had escaped death. He knew his mistress was so lovely, she wouldn’t sentence him to death.
He shook his head: "The mistress’s punishment is fair. I have no objections."
Seeing his good attitude, Lian Hua was satisfied. She lifted her hand, palm up, and said: "Xiao Qing, where is my treasured sword?"
Xiao Qing hurriedly handed over the rattan that had been refitted with a handle.
Xiao Linzi shivered, lowered his head, not daring to look, and obediently stretched out his hand.
Lian Hua, holding the rattan with an imposing air, flicked the rattan and revealed a mischievous smile.
Oh, this was so satisfying. Punishing people really was the most pleasing thing, haha, His Majesty loved to punish her, and not without reason.
She waved the rattan above Xiao Linzi’s palm, faking a few strikes, each time making Xiao Linzi shiver, before finally hitting him lightly, three times.
Happily done with the teasing, Lian Hua was generous with her praise. Starting with Xiao Linzi’s performance as lookout, she commended Xiao Jizi for being attentive and for giving her enough time to hide things.
It occurred to her there should be a two-tiered defense. In addition to the lookout, in case His Majesty waltzed in unexpectedly, there should be a warning system like Xiao Jizi’s to ensure foolproof coverage.
Ah, how clever she was!
No sooner said than done, she slapped the table and shared her idea with Nanny Qi, her eyes twinkling, hoping for praise.
"Mhm, if you think it’s feasible, then go ahead and do it. Don’t worry about anything," Nanny Qi said with a smile, indulging the Little Lady’s happiness. She had never expected the Little Lady to be able to deceive the Emperor, that wily man.
All Lian Hua needed was Nanny Qi’s approval, and she was very happy, especially since Nanny Qi always supported her unconditionally.
Thus, she excitedly began to arrange the second tier of defense, and after some consideration, she decided to assign Xiao Linzi to redeem himself by taking on the new role.
Fearing Xiao Linzi was too foolish and might give them away, she had him practice: "You’ll be outside the door; if you see His Majesty coming from afar, how would you remind me?"
Xiao Linzi thought for a moment and hesitated: "Should I just loudly say ’His Majesty is coming’?"
Lian Hua frowned: "That doesn’t seem quite right, does it?"
It’s a bit like announcing there’s no silver here, isn’t it?
After another thought, Xiao Linzi realized it wasn’t quite right. They already had one such incident with Brother Xiao Ji intercepting His Majesty. He then said: "Then should I say ’His Majesty is coming again’?"
Lian Hua’s brows furrowed even tighter, "Still no good, it’s as if His Majesty can’t come."
Her brows creased with concern, she muttered to herself, "Oh dear... it’s somewhat difficult, His Majesty is so intelligent, and you’re so dense, how can we make it so you remind me without raising any alarm and without letting His Majesty realize?"
The problem was that Xiao Linzi’s mind wasn’t good at twists and turns, even if you taught him what to say, he wouldn’t be able to apply it flexibly. Hence, a method suitable for Xiao Linzi had to be found.
Hmm, I still need to think of a good method.
If it were Xiao Jizi, she wouldn’t have this worry.
Xiao Linzi fell into deep thought, indeed, His Majesty was so intelligent, he couldn’t think of any good method.
Xiao Qing also started pondering with her finger in her mouth.
Xiao Jizi, on the other hand, stood with his hands tucked away, silent, keeping his eyes on his nose and his nose on his heart, trying his best to lessen his presence. If he were to tell his master, His Majesty might have already noticed, and he would be beaten to death, right?
Yes, he definitely would. The master hadn’t taken away the weapon yet...
Suddenly, the only sound in the Side Hall was Nanny Qi leisurely sipping tea, she felt that watching the little girls and these Young Eunuchs and Little Palace Maids frolic every day made for rather beautiful days.
With her head propped on her hands, Lian Hua thought and thought, her eyebrows furrowing and relaxing, until an idea struck her head, heh, she had an idea!
She slapped the table, unable to contain her joy, but then she suddenly thought, if she, being so clever, couldn’t manage it, could Xiao Linzi do it?
Lian Hua was somewhat doubtful, continuously scrutinizing Xiao Linzi with her eyes, weighing the feasibility.
Xiao Linzi almost panicked under her gaze, thinking about hiding behind Brother Xiao Ji.
Seeing the stupid and dull look on Xiao Linzi’s face, Lian Hua felt a niggle of worry in her heart, hmm, this really was a big problem.
Or should she just let it be for now and push forward with it? Duck onto perch first?
Fine, let’s move forward while watching, let him continue with this for now!
Having made her decision, Lian Hua was spirited and energetically told everyone to wait for her while she went inside to fetch something.
Alone in the inner chamber, she fumbled around, and it was unclear from where she produced a book, triumphantly carrying it to the small hall, and with a slap placed it into Xiao Linzi’s hands, to the astonishment of everyone.
Hands on hips and brimming with confidence, Lian Hua asked Xiao Linzi, "Do you know how to read?"
Xiao Linzi, confused, stared seriously at the characters in the book for a while, then read aloud, "The Book of Poetry!"
Then, he nodded his head.
Next, he saw a flash of light swiftly pass through the almond-shaped eyes of his master, suddenly brightening up, making him feel a chill in his heart.
Clasping her fists to her lips, Lian Hua cleared her throat, paced around Xiao Linzi for two turns, her mind contemplating the profound truths to speak of. She intended to persuade Xiao Linzi with sentiment and reason to undertake this task.
Xiao Linzi grew increasingly nervous; over these days, he had also gotten to know his master’s temperament well. This demeanor seemed like his master was preparing to teach him a lesson...
Everyone else was clueless and watched Lian Hua intently.
Yet Lian Hua felt it was about time, a slightly uncomfortable yet mischievous expression appeared on her face, as she stood with her back straight and hands behind her, she said with stirring conviction, "Under His Majesty’s governance, the land is at peace now, the people live and work in happiness, and the world praises His Majesty as a wise sovereign.
But what people do not know is that from a young age, His Majesty braved the harsh cold and scorching heat, diligently studying books, doing the extraordinary, achieving the impossible.
In places unseen, it is His Majesty who bears the weight of the world, allowing the people to have the good days they enjoy now. "
